Expressions of offering help
Can/ may I help you?
How can I help/assist you?
What can I do for you?
Is there anything I can do for you?
What if I help you?
Do you need any help?
Would you like me to help?
Let me help.
Can I give you a hand?
Responding to an offer

Expressions of asking for help
Can I ask a favour?
Could you help me for a second?
I wonder if you could help me with this?
Can/could you help me?
Can you give me a hand with this?
Give me a hand with this, will you?
Lend me a hand with this, will you?
I need some help please!
I can’t manage. Can you help?
Responding to asking for help
